How to prepare for a job interview at Intoloop
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of a Service Advisor inside out. Familiarise yourself with the dealership's services and products, as well as common customer queries. This will help you demonstrate your knowledge and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.
✨Show Off Your People Skills
Since communication is key for this role, think of examples from your past experiences where you've excelled in customer service or sales. Be ready to share stories that highlight your ability to connect with customers and resolve their issues effectively.
✨Demonstrate Your Drive
The dealership is looking for someone who shows enthusiasm and commitment. During the interview, express your passion for the automotive industry and your eagerness to contribute to the team. Share your career goals and how this position aligns with them.
✨Prepare Questions
At the end of the interview, you'll likely be asked if you have any questions. Prepare thoughtful questions about the training programme, team dynamics, or performance expectations. This shows that you're engaged and serious about the opportunity.
